Properties:
No odor or taste. Specific gravity: 1.37--1.40. Soluble in chloroform, acetone, benzene, toluene, carbon disulfate; Insoluble in water and gasoline.
Application:
Generally used as a secondary accelerator or as a booster for sulphenamides to achieve faster cure rate. Distinguished by very good processing safety in comparison with other thiurams, high curing activity and no discoloration. No cure actinty in the absence of added elemental sulphur. An excellent accelerator for polychloroprene in association with DPG and Sulphur.
Storage:
Keep container tightly closed in a cool, well-ventilated place. The recommended max. storage life is 2 years when stored under normal conditions.

No odor and poison. Irritating to the skin and the respiratory tract. Specific gravity: 1.38--1.44. Soluble in chloroform, acetone, benzene; hardly soluble in carbon tetrachloride, ethyl alcohol & insoluble in water or gasoline.
Can be used as a single accelerator, as a secondary accelerator or as a sulphur donor in most sulphur-cured elastomers. Scorchy and gives fast cure rates. Produces an excellent vulcanisation plateau with good heat aging and compression set resistance In sulphurless and EV cure systems. Good color retention is obtained in non-black vulcanisation. A valuable secondary accelerator for EPDM. May be used as a retarder in the vulcanisation of polychloroprene rubber with ETU.

Grey or light yellow in color with bitter taste and slight odor. Specific gravity: 1.26--1.32, Soluble in ethanol, carbon tetrachloride, acetone, benzene, carbon disulfate, chloroform; Hardly soluble in gasoline and insoluble in water. It is not hygroscopic.
Provides fast cure rate and high modulus development in NR, SBR, BR and blends. Normally used alone or with small quantities of ultra Accelerators in tire compounds or industrial rubber products.
Keep container tightly closed in a cool, well-ventilated place. The recommended max. storage life is 1 year when stored under normal conditions.

A little bitter taste. Specific gravity: 1.50--1.59. Soluble in chloroform, toluene, benzene, carbon tetrachloride. Insoluble in water and ethyl alcohol.
Given flat, moderately fast cures in NR and SR. Also used in a wide range of general purpose rubber. Non-staining/non-discolouring in "white" socks; use as a plasticiser and/or retarder in polychloroprene rubber. Secondary acceleration is usually required for synthetic polymers. Better scorch safety than MBT.

Slightly foul odor and bitter taste, nonpoisonous. Specific gravity: 1.46-1.52.Soluble in ethyl acetone, acetone, dilute solution of sodium hydroxide and sodium carbonate, ethyl alcohol. Not easily soluble in benzene. Insoluble in water and gasoline.
Used for NR, IR, SBR, NBR, HR and EPDM.One of the mainly used acidic accelerators currontly and a medium fast primary accelerator. Imparts excellent aging properties, when used both alone and in combination with DM, TMTD and many others, mainly basic accelerators for higher activity. But care should be taken because it has a slight tendency to scorch. Unsuitable for use in the manufacture of food contact materials. Mainly used in the manufacture of tires, tubes, footwear, rubber belts and hoses etc.

No odor or poison. Specific gravity:1.13--1.23. Soluble in chloroform, toluene benzene and ethanol; Insoluble in gasoline and water. Not hygroscopic.
Used as a secondary accelerator with thiazoles and sulphenamides in NR and SBR compounds. Exhibits better storage stability compared to thiuram and dithiocarbamates but is not so active. DPG can be used in latex as secondary gelling agent (foam stabilizer) in the silico-flouride foam process.
Keep container tightly closed in a cool, well-ventilated place. The recommended maximum storage life is 2 years when stored under normal conditions.

A slight odor. Specific gravity: 1.26--1.31. Soluble in benzene, chloroform, carbon disulfide; Insoluble in water.
A medium fast primary accelerator suitable for NR, IR, SBR, NBR, HR and EPDM. An outstanding delayed action accelerator. Be top effective and safe when used at ordinary processing temperatures, causing no scorches. Vulcanized show excellent physical property and quick complete. Usually used alone, when activated by DPG, TMTD and TMTM.
